Role Description We’re seeking a Senior Full Stack Engineer to help drive the evolution of our platform—building robust web applications, APIs, and data systems that power our products. This role is a global opportunity that requires a 4 hour overlap with US Mountain Time. What You'll Build: - Build and operate the systems that deliver Forager.ai's people and organization data to platform customers at scale. - Real-time enrichment APIs — person/org lookup, contact data, reverse search for waterfall platforms. - Bulk data feed delivery — maintain the Snowflake service delivering billions of data points daily to Data Feed customers. - Elasticsearch search infrastructure — indexing, query design, relevance tuning, and cluster scaling for person/company search and filtering APIs. - ETL pipelines — workers, task queues, and transformations moving data into APIs and feed exports. - Customer-facing web app and developer experience — React/TypeScript app, docs, onboarding flows, and self-serve surfaces. - Compliance and observability — data-sourcing proofs, GDPR/PII handling, and scoreboard metrics for each Data Quality dimension. Qualifications - 5+ years building and operating production web applications and APIs. - Strong proficiency in Python / Django and React / TypeScript. - Hands-on experience operating Elasticsearch at scale — schema design, query tuning, cluster management. - Production experience with PostgreSQL, Redis, and async task systems (Celery / RabbitMQ or equivalent). - Demonstrated track record building and operating ETL pipelines that move significant data volumes reliably. - Comfortable with AWS (ECS, S3, CloudWatch) and CI/CD pipelines (GitHub Actions or equivalent). - Experience operating services in production — observability, on-call, incident response. - Strong written communication; comfortable owning documentation as a deliverable. Role Description We're looking for a AI/ML Engineer (Senior/Staff/Principal) - Threat Detection who will design, build, and operationalize the detection algorithms, ML inference pipelines, and risk aggregation systems that power our autonomous threat detection platform. You'll work at the intersection of identity security, behavioral analytics, and applied machine learning — building production systems that analyze ZTNA audit logs in near real-time, surface high-fidelity threat signals, and feed into our Risk Sentinel enforcement engine to continuously harden access decisions. Key Responsibilities - Your engineering work will directly enable next-generation capabilities, including: - Threat Detection Engine: Rule-based, behavioral, and ML-based detections across identity, access, network, and session domains — including brute force, privilege escalation, impossible travel, data exfiltration, and off-hours activity. - ML Anomaly Detection: Production models using Isolation Forest, One-Class SVM, and Autoencoder neural networks to surface behavioral outliers that rules miss. - Risk Aggregation & Enforcement: Normalize and weight detection signals into user and device risk scores; integrate with the AppGate Risk Sentinel engine to drive continuous access decisions. - Real-Time Detection Pipeline: Near real-time streaming architecture ingesting ZTNA audit logs, with stateless detection outputs feeding incrementally updated risk scores. - AI Agent Security: Detect drift, unexpected resource escalation, and signs of compromise or misconfiguration in autonomous AI agents operating within the ZTNA environment. - Autonomous Remediation (Roadmap): Build the enforcement feedback loop enabling the Risk Sentinel to auto-remediate high-confidence threats and support AI-assisted investigation. - Design and implement detection algorithms spanning authentication, authorization, network/location, data access, session management, and temporal behavioral domains. - Train, evaluate, and deploy ML models on real-world identity and network telemetry; tune for production precision and recall targets. - Architect and operate the detection pipeline — from audit log ingestion through risk aggregation and Risk Sentinel integration. - Define the detection taxonomy — categorizing, prioritizing, and lifecycle-managing the full detection library using a scalable detection family model. - Instrument and improve signal quality — measuring MTTD, false positive rates, and MITRE ATT&CK coverage; partnering with red teams to validate detections against real attack scenarios. - Collaborate cross-functionally with security, product, and platform engineering to align detection coverage with customer threat models and roadmap priorities. Qualifications - 7+ years of production AI/ML engineering experience, with a strong preference for candidates who have built threat detection, UEBA, ITDR, or identity security platforms at leading security or cloud companies. - Detection algorithm expertise: Hands-on experience designing detections for identity-based threats — credential compromise, privilege escalation, insider activity, behavioral anomalies, and data exfiltration. - ML proficiency: Anomaly detection (Isolation Forest, One-Class SVM, Autoencoders), statistical methods, and supervised classification using PyTorch or TensorFlow. - Data & streaming engineering: Real-time or near-real-time pipeline experience (Kafka, Flink, Spark Streaming, or equivalent); familiarity with lakehouse formats (Apache Iceberg, Parquet). - Security domain knowledge: MITRE ATT&CK, identity threat kill chains, ZTNA or network access control systems, and audit log analysis. - Bonus: Experience with detection-as-code frameworks (Sigma, YARA), ZTNA platforms, LLMs or GNNs applied to security, or publications at USENIX, CCS, NeurIPS, or ICML. - Mindset: Mission-driven, production-focused, signal-obsessed.
